1. Components of a complete flower

A complete flower consists of four parts: calyx, corolla, stamens and pistil. The calyx is composed of sepals, and the corolla is composed of petals. Any flower that is missing any of the four parts is considered an incomplete flower. In addition, flowers that have both stamens and pistils are called bisexual flowers, and perfect flowers must be bisexual. A flower that only has pistils or stamens is called a unisexual flower. Unisexual flowers are not complete flowers.

2. What are the common complete flowers?

There are many kinds of complete flowers that are common in life, such as peony, rose, rape flower, cabbage flower, apricot flower, pear flower, morning glory, peach flower, magnolia, crabapple flower, rose flower, hawthorn flower, apple flower, broad bean flower, plum flower, cowpea flower, tomato flower, osmanthus, etc.

3. What are the common incomplete flowers?

There are many kinds of incomplete flowers that are common in life, such as willow flowers, watermelon flowers, loofah flowers, cucumber flowers, poplar flowers, pumpkin flowers, eucommia flowers, calla lilies, chestnut flowers, mulberry flowers, cattails, loofahs, etc. Most common vegetables have incomplete flowers.
